Stories Poem by Edwina Reizer

Stories



If you were alive today
what stories woud you tell me?
Stories of what it's like without me
or of what comes after this?

Or would you hold back
all those things
and play upon my heartstrings,
then give me one more kiss?

I've often wondered if there is
a memory lane for lovers
where thought and memory covers
all our times of bliss?

If you were alive today
those stories you would bring me
would thrill me and please me
Your stories I still miss.
